Strong footballer.: In order to become strong for sports, you need a diet that will support a strength training exercise program. This would include ample amounts of lean protein along with complex carbohydrates. Keep saturated fats and trans fats low. It’s small, frequent meals throughout the day (every 2 to 3 hours). And plenty of water along with this high protein intake.
